Nakayashiki Co., Ltd., a company founded 137 years ago and headquartered in Kitakyushu, Fukuoka Prefecture, has launched a new detached-home proposal centered on the sale of residential lots and has renewed its detached housing website accordingly. The renewal goes beyond simply listing housing information. The website has been redesigned to help visitors more easily imagine what kind of life they could lead on each parcel of land. Nakayashiki is proposing a new approach to homebuilding that integrates land, buildings, and lifestyle. In recent years, rising housing and material prices, along with the growing complexity of land searches and home planning, have left more prospective buyers unsure of what criteria to use or unable to decide after comparing too many options. Nakayashiki has long supported customers from the land-search stage through home construction, but as search conditions expand, balancing ideals with reality becomes more difficult, often prolonging land selection and meetings. To address this, Nakayashiki will leverage the regional network and track record it has cultivated as a locally rooted company to offer carefully selected residential subdivisions that it considers highly livable. These sites are chosen with attention to surrounding environment, convenience, and streetscape. By selling land with development plans and site conditions already organized, the company also aims to make it easier for buyers to reduce additional costs such as land preparation and improvement work after purchase. For the homes themselves, Nakayashiki will propose subdivision houses designed around each site’s lifestyle potential and circulation flow, drawing on its extensive homebuilding experience. It will also introduce a new option that allows customers to choose from three set plans, meeting the needs of buyers who still want some degree of choice. Rather than offering fully custom design, the company provides professionally selected plans to reduce meeting burden, clarify total costs, streamline the homebuilding process, and improve design and construction efficiency. Nakayashiki says its goal is not merely to sell land or houses, but to propose what kind of life can be lived in each subdivision, considering the surrounding environment, streetscape, child-rearing environment, and daily living routes.
